The expedition leaves fron Royal Park, Melborne
-
-
Burke divided his party at Menindee leaveing William Wight in charge of most of the stores and equipment to be taken to a base depot at Coopers Creek
-
Bourke and his party arrive at the Coopers Creek depot.
-
A depot is established at Coopers Creek for supplies and food to be stored
-
Around this date, Burke and his party leave King and Grey, Burke and Wills attempt to reach the coast, but instead they only sight it from a distance due to the dense mangrove population.
-
Grey dies in the arms of Burke, leaving him more determined to finish his expedition.
-
Burke abnd his pasrty return to the depot at Coopers Creek with Brahe's party having left 7 hours earlier the same day. The reason they left was Brahe had already waited an extra month beyond what was agreed.
-
In late June, Burke and Wills die within days of each other, leaving King on his own. King joined the Yentruwanta Tribe and lived with them for several months.
-
Howitt's Party eventually find King who had been living with the Yantruwanta Tribe for several months.
